When the localized electric field around a high-voltage conductor exceeds the breakdown strength of air, the air ionizes. This causes a luminous violet glow, a hissing noise, and power loss. The book details formulas to calculate the critical disruptive voltage and visual corona inception voltage. 5. Distribution Systems Bakshi
